Cerberus ODC in Collaboration with NVIDIA Launches All-American AI-RAN Stack, Enabling AI-Native 5G Today and Accelerating the Path to 6G
TelAve News/10879914
Software-Defined Architecture Delivers Breakthrough Performance Gains, Unlocking Distributed AI Inference at the Forward Edge and Powering AI for the Physical World
NEW YORK - TelAve -- Open RAN Development Company (ODC), a Cerberus Capital Management portfolio company, today announced the successful integration of its AI-native RAN software with the NVIDIA AI Aerial platform. This milestone delivers a production-ready, All-American AI-RAN stack that achieves an unprecedented leap in performance, establishing a new benchmark for wireless networks and creating a powerful, distributed AI inference engine at the network Forward Edge.
The fully integrated, software-defined solution was demonstrated at the NVIDIA GTC DC conference, October 27-29.
A New Benchmark for RAN Performance
By leveraging the NVIDIA AI Aerial platform, which includes the Grace Hopper Superchip and CUDA-accelerated libraries, ODC's AI-native software stack has achieved breakthrough performance gains compared to traditional CPU-based vRAN architectures. These results establish a new industry benchmark for performance, proving the transformative value of a GPU-accelerated RAN architecture.

The fully integrated, software-defined solution was demonstrated at the NVIDIA GTC DC conference, October 27-29.
A New Benchmark for RAN Performance
By leveraging the NVIDIA AI Aerial platform, which includes the Grace Hopper Superchip and CUDA-accelerated libraries, ODC's AI-native software stack has achieved breakthrough performance gains compared to traditional CPU-based vRAN architectures. These results establish a new industry benchmark for performance, proving the transformative value of a GPU-accelerated RAN architecture.
Key performance achievements include:
- 380x faster Massive MIMO L2 processing
- 40x faster L1 signal processing
- 7x increase in cell capacity
- 3.5x higher power efficiency per cell
These "x-factor" improvements are a direct result of an AI-native architecture that offloads the most compute-intensive functions to the GPU, revolutionizing the efficiency and capability of the wireless network.
